🖋️ React TipTap Editor IVR2

📝 Overview
A modern, feature-rich WYSIWYG editor for React applications, built on top of TipTap and shadcn UI. Crafted with attention to detail by Indravardhan Reddy, this editor combines elegant design with powerful functionality.

✨ Features
📝 Rich Text Editing - Format text with bold, italic, underline, strikethrough, and more
🔤 Typography Controls - Headings, paragraph styles, and flexible font options
📋 Lists & Tables - Ordered/unordered lists and comprehensive table support
🖼️ Media Embedding - Seamlessly insert images, attachments, videos, and other media
🔗 Link Management - Create, edit, and manage hyperlinks with rich preview
📐 Advanced Formatting - Code blocks with syntax highlighting, math formulas with KaTeX, and more
📊 Diagrams & Drawings - Support for Mermaid diagrams and Excalidraw sketches
📱 Responsive Design - Works flawlessly across desktop and mobile devices
🎨 Customizable - Easily theme to match your application's design
🧩 Extensible - Add your own custom extensions through the robust extension API
🔌 Modern Architecture - Built with React, TypeScript, and Tailwind CSS

📱 Available Extensions
The editor comes with a rich set of extensions including:

Text formatting: Bold, Italic, Underline, Strike, etc.
Block elements: Headings, Paragraphs, Blockquotes, etc.
Lists: Bullet lists, Ordered lists, Task lists
Media: Images, Attachments, Videos, Embeds
Special elements: Tables, Code blocks, Math formulas
Visual tools: Mermaid diagrams, Excalidraw drawings
And many more!

⚙️ Props
Prop	Type	Required	Description
content	string	Yes	Initial content for the editor
output	'html' | 'json'	Yes	Output format for the content
extensions	Extension[]	Yes	Array of extensions to use
onChangeContent	(content: string) => void	No	Callback when content changes
useEditorOptions	UseEditorOptions	No	Options for the editor
ref	RefObject	No	Ref to access the editor instance
